Https как работает шифрование
HTTPS (Hypertext Transfer Protocol Secure) представляет собой расширение протокола HTTP, которое обеспечивает безопасность передачи данных в сети интернет. Благодаря шифрованию информации этот протокол защищает данные пользователей от перехвата и несанкционированного доступа, что делает его неотъемлемой частью веб-браузинга в современном мире.
Шифрование в HTTPS основано на использовании протоколов SSL (Secure Sockets Layer) и TLS (Transport Layer Security), которые создают защищённое соединение между клиентом и сервером. Это соединение не только защищает личные данные пользователей, такие как пароли и номера кредитных карт, но и гарантирует целостность передаваемой информации.
В последние годы с ростом числа кибератак и утечек данных важность использования HTTPS увеличивается. Многие веб-сайты уже перешли на зашифрованные соединения, а поисковые системы отдают предпочтение сайтам, использующим HTTPS, в своих результатах поиска, что добавляет ещё один стимул для внедрения этой технологии.
HTTPS и его шифрование: Как это работает и зачем это нужно
В современном мире, где цифровая информация передается с безумной скоростью, вопрос безопасности данных становится особенно актуальным. HTTPS (HyperText Transfer Protocol Secure) является неотъемлемой частью этой безопасности. Но как его шифрование работает и почему это так важно для каждого пользователя интернета? В этой статье мы подробно рассмотрим, как функционирует HTTPS, его преимущества, а также ответим на другие важные вопросы, касающиеся этого протокола.
Когда вы переходите на сайт с HTTPS, вы можете быть уверены, что соединение между вашим браузером и сервером защищено. Это достигается благодаря использованию технологий шифрования, которые делают данные недоступными для посторонних лиц. Но давайте разберемся, что именно стоит за этим процессом и как он работает на техническом уровне.
Прежде всего, стоит отметить, что HTTPS — это надстройка над HTTP. То есть, если HTTP занимается передачей данных между клиентом и сервером, то HTTPS добавляет уровень шифрования для большей безопасности. Основные компоненты, позволяющие реализовать это шифрование, — это SSL (Secure Sockets Layer) и его более современная версия TLS (Transport Layer Security).
Когда пользователь пытается установить соединение с сайтом, который использует HTTPS, происходит следующий процесс:
1. **Установление соединения**. Когда ваш браузер обращается к серверу с HTTPS, он запрашивает «сертификат безопасности», который демонстрирует, что сервер является подлинным и защищенным.
2. **Проверка сертификата**. Браузер проверяет, действителен ли сертификат, и если он одобрен, продолжает процесс.
3. **Обмен ключами**. После проверки сертификата создается симметричный ключ, который используется для шифрования данных. Этот ключ передается между клиентом и сервером, обычно с использованием асимметричного шифрования, которое требует пары ключей: открытого и закрытого.
4. **Шифрование данных**. Как только ключ установлен, все передаваемые данные шифруются. Это означает, что даже если данные будут перехвачены, злоумышленник не сможет их прочитать без доступа к ключу.
5. **Кодирование и декодирование**. Во время передачи данных, информация кодируется на стороне клиента, а затем декодируется на сервере и наоборот. Это еще больше увеличивает защиту и защищает личную информацию пользователей.
Как вы могли заметить, HTTPS использует подход, основанный на сочетании асимметричного и симметричного шифрования. Этот метод обеспечивает безопасность по нескольким причинам:
- **Асимметричное шифрование**. Подходит для передачи ключа, но медленнее, чем симметричное. Используя ключи, система создает уникальные шифрованные сообщения, которые могут быть расшифрованы только владельцем соответствующего закрытого ключа.
- **Симметричное шифрование**. Позволяет быстро шифровать и дешифровать данные с использованием одного и того же ключа. Именно этот процесс обеспечивает быструю и безопасную отправку больших объемов данных.
Важно отметить, что наличие HTTPS не означает абсолютной безопасности. Этот протокол защищает только соединение между вашим браузером и сервером. Но если на сайте есть уязвимости или если сервер непосредственно скомпрометирован, bilgileriniz tehlikeye girebilir. Поэтому всегда следует заниматься выборами безопасных сайтов и регулярно обновлять софт и антивирусные программы.
Теперь давайте рассмотрим, какие преимущества предоставляет использование HTTPS как для пользователей, так и для владельцев сайтов.
Для пользователей:
- **Безопасность**. HTTPS шифрует данные, что защищает личные данные от перехвата злоумышленниками.
- **Доверие**. Заметка о безопасном соединении (иконка замка в адресной строке) повышает доверие к веб-сайтам, что уменьшает риск фишинга.
- **Конфиденциальность**. Безопасное соединение помогает сохранять личные данные и действия пользователей в секрете.
Для владельцев сайтов:
- **Улучшение SEO**. Поисковые системы, такие как Google, отдают предпочтение сайтам с HTTPS, что может повысить их ранжирование.
- **Защита от атак**. Использование HTTPS обеспечивает защиту от определенных типов атак, таких как «человек посередине» (MITM).
- **Клиентская база**. Пользователи с большей вероятностью будут доверять вашему сайту и совершать покупки, если увидят, что он безопасен.
Наличие HTTPS на вашем сайте — это не только возможность защитить своих пользователей, но и необходимость в современном интернете. Принятие мер безопасности поможет не только обеспечить защиту данных, но и улучшить репутацию вашего ресурса.
С 2014 года Google активно продвигает использование HTTPS, что стало одной из причин, по которой многие веб-мастера начали внедрять этот протокол на свои сайты. В 2019 году Google дополнительно объявил, что сайты с HTTPS получают небольшой бонус в ранжировании, что увеличивает необходимость в применении шифрования для повышения видимости в поисковых системах.
Кроме того, пользователям следует помнить о том, что не все, что начинается с HTTPS, является безопасным. Злоумышленники могут делать фишинговые сайты, копируя действительные ресурсы и устанавливая на них сертификаты безопасности. Поэтому важно обращаться к известным и проверенным ресурсам и всегда проверять адрес сайта перед введением личных данных.
Для проверки безопасности сайта вы можете также воспользоваться различными онлайн-сервисами, которые предоставляют информацию о статусе сертификата и наличии уязвимостей.
В заключение, HTTPS играет критическую роль в обеспечении безопасности данных в интернете. Шифрование, используемое в этом протоколе, защищает ваши данные и повышает уровень доверия к веб-ресурсам. С каждым годом число сайтов с HTTPS продолжает расти, что делает интернет более безопасным. Обеспечивая безопасность своим пользователям, владельцы сайтов помогают развивать культуру безопасности и конфиденциальности, что критически важно в условиях современного цифрового мира.
Таким образом, если вы хотите оставаться в безопасности в интернете, обязательно обращайте внимание на наличие HTTPS на сайтах, которые вы посещаете. Это ваше первое и важное оружие в борьбе за безопасность личных данных.
Шифрование — это как гарантированное письмо, которое не может быть прочитано никем, кроме адресата.
Бенджамин Франклин
| Этап | Описание | Значение |
|---|---|---|
| Инициация | Браузер отправляет запрос на сервер через HTTPS. | Установка безопасного соединения. |
| Обмен ключами | Сервер отправляет сертификат с открытым ключом. | Гарантия безопасности соединения. |
| Установление сеансового ключа | Браузер и сервер генерируют общий сеансовый ключ. | Шифрование данных при передаче. |
| Шифрование данных | Данные передаются в закодированном виде с использованием сеансового ключа. | Защита информации от перехвата. |
| Декодирование | Сервер декодирует полученные данные с помощью сеансового ключа. | Доступ к оригинальной информации. |
| Завершение сеанса | Сеанс завершен, ключи аннулируются. | Обеспечение безопасности на будущее. |
Основные проблемы по теме "Https как работает шифрование"
Необходимость постоянного обновления шифров
Одной из основных проблем связанных с работой шифрования в протоколе HTTPS является необходимость постоянного обновления используемых алгоритмов и ключей. С развитием криптографических методов, старые шифры могут стать уязвимыми, что создает угрозу для конфиденциальности данных пользователей.
Проблема доверия к сертификатам
Еще одной важной проблемой является доверие к выданным сертификатам. При работе с HTTPS необходимо убедиться, что сертификат, предоставленный сервером, действительно принадлежит ему и был выдан доверенным удостоверяющим центром. Несанкционированные или поддельные сертификаты могут стать причиной утечки конфиденциальной информации.
Возможность атак методом перехвата и злоупотребления
Еще одной проблемой является возможность атак методом перехвата и злоупотребления. Несмотря на шифрование данных, злоумышленники могут использовать уязвимости в реализации протокола или алгоритмов шифрования для перехвата информации, манипуляции сессией и других вредоносных действий.
Какие основные принципы работы шифрования в HTTPS?
Основные принципы работы шифрования в HTTPS включают использование симметричного и ассиметричного шифрования для обеспечения конфиденциальности данных и проверки подлинности сервера.
Какие алгоритмы шифрования используются в HTTPS?
В HTTPS часто используются алгоритмы шифрования, такие как AES (Advanced Encryption Standard) для симметричного шифрования и RSA (Rivest-Shamir-Adleman) для ассиметричного шифрования.
Что такое SSL и TLS в контексте HTTPS?
SSL (Secure Sockets Layer) и его более современная версия TLS (Transport Layer Security) - это протоколы, используемые в HTTPS для обеспечения шифрования передачи данных между клиентом и сервером.
Материал подготовлен командой seo-kompaniya.ru
Читать ещё
Главное в тренде
SEO оптимизация интернет-магазина
Как качественно настроить сео интернет-магазина? Какие основные этапы поисковой оптимизации необходимо соблюдать для роста трафика из поиска?Наши услуги
SEO аудит сайта Продвижение сайта по позициям SMM продвижение Настройка контекстной рекламы SEO оптимизация